A West African baby born with two spines and four legs is recovering from a rare surgery in Illinois. Surgeons had to separate bone, blood vessels and nerves in the six hour operation at Advocate Children's Hospital in Park Ridge earlier this month. Ten-month-old Dominique was born in the Ivory Coast with what's known as a parasitic twin. The other twin never fully developed. Doctors expect Dominique to live a normal, fully functional life.
